Frequently Asked Questions

We've created this page to help answer any questions you may have about our joining a group

Does is matter what stage or where I am on my journey..?

The simple answer is no. We have people who are starting to understand their experience, some who have reported their abuser and others who do not want to. Others have accessed specialist support services, some are on waiting lists and some aren't ready to access that support yet. It doesn't matter where you are on your journey, or if you have or haven't accessed specialist support services. Our aim is to offer a safe space of acceptance and understanding, where you can socialise and nurture new friendships and feel like you belong.

Who decides which group is for me..?

You do. We want people to decide where they feel the most comfortable, as this is different for everyone. What connects us is our lived experience. We have one group that is only for women, the others are open to all. 

Will I be asked or have to talk about my experiences in detail?

No, and why would we? We are not a professional support service, we are a peer support group. The two are very different in what they offer to victim-survivors. However, should you ever wish to talk about the impact your experience is having on you, we will listen. Our shared lived experience is what brings us together, even without even needing to say what happened to us. 

Who can I expect to see at a session..?

Our sessions are ran by our volunteers, they may differ each time you come, but they are all wonderful people. And when we are able to some of the team behind Survivor Sanctuary will also be there, but as participants - as they are survivors too. Who shows up to each session differs. We won't chase you and ask why you didn't attend a session, and whilst you don't need to let us know that you are planning on coming, it is helpful for us to know how many people to plan for. 

Is there a referral list or wait time? 

You can self refer to the group, you do not need a be referred by a professional. There is no wait list/waiting time to join. You get to choose if and when you come to a session, there is no minimum requirement or commitment. We are here for you as and when you need us, no questions asked.
